Quick Summary

The Department of the Army, specifically Assured Airspace Access Systems (A3S), is conducting market research through this Request for Information (RFI) to identify sources capable of designing, producing, and delivering a micro transponder for Army Aviation platforms. This RFI aims to enhance situational awareness and interoperability by addressing Size, Weight, and Power-consumption (SWaP) constraints. Responses are due by March 19, 2026.

Scope of Work

The Army requires a miniaturized Identification Friend or Foe (IFF) and Automatic Dependent Surveillance-Broadcast (ADS-B) transponder. Key performance specifications include:

  • Operational Modes: Modes 1, 2, 3/A, C, 5L1&2, and S.
  • Connectivity: Minimum two (2) Ethernet (10BaseT/100BaseT) ports.
  • Cryptographic Compatibility: KIV-77 and KIV-79 crypto appliqués.
  • Power: 28VAC input (MIL-STD-704A-F compliant), 500W max output.
  • Compliance: DoD AIMS (diversity antennae), MIL-STD-810H (-40°C to 71°C), MIL-STD-461G (E3 resilient), DoDI 8500 (cyber resilient), MIL-STD-882E (System Safety).
  • ADS-B: 1090MHz Extended Squitter ADS-B In and Out.
  • Physical: Approx. 3.4" L x 2.5" W x 1.0" H, not exceeding 200 grams.
  • MRL: Minimum 7.

Information Requested

Respondents should provide a concise response (not exceeding 10 pages) addressing:

  • Company Profile: Overview, core competencies, relevant experience with military aviation electronics, and past performance.
  • Technical Approach: Description of proposed solution meeting Section 2.1 requirements, including details on modes, crypto-compatibility, and physical dimensions.
  • Technology Readiness Level (TRL): Assessment of proposed system/components.
  • Integration and Interoperability: Information on ease of integration with existing Army aviation platforms.
